Transaction ea51b93e1438ff0f509724c23d9402690679ed6fd63767034413ce7ccf391a43

1 Input
2 Outputs
  • ea51b93e1438ff0f509724c23d9402690679ed6fd63767034413ce7ccf391a43:0
  • value  890000
    address  18gdkY3CZhT66eRopXtKckUFXAsW7WULt7
  • ea51b93e1438ff0f509724c23d9402690679ed6fd63767034413ce7ccf391a43:1
  • value  17871992
    address  1CzxasSae7JTmYPPgB7DPB13yt1s7MbUrC